PIMCO Mortgage-Backed Securities Active ETF (PMBS) To Go Ex-Dividend on July 1st

PIMCO Mortgage-Backed Securities Active ETF (NASDAQ:PMBSGet Free Report) declared a dividend on Tuesday, June 30th, NASDAQ Dividends reports. Stockholders of record on Wednesday, July 1st will be paid a dividend of 0.18 per share on Monday, July 6th.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, July 1st.

About PIMCO Mortgage-Backed Securities Active ETF

The PIMCO Mortgage-Backed Securities Active Exchange-Traded Fund (PMBS)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und invests in mortgage-backed securities, seeking actively managed risk-adjusted return potential. The fund aims to provide core, high-quality, intermediate-term exposure through fundamental selection and weighting. PMBS was launched on Sep 20, 2024 and is issued by PIMCO.
